Kernel: Remove "supervisor" bit from PhysicalPage

Instead of each PhysicalPage knowing whether it comes from the
supervisor pages or from the user pages, we can just check in both
sets when freeing a page.

It's just a handful of pointer range checks, nothing expensive.
